ABOUT 2240 - A net with call signs of CWnnn. NCS seemed to be
CW321 who sometimes asked for relays from other
stations. Additional calls: CW705 and others. NCS
would ask for check-ins by hundreds groups - "Are
there any 400 stations wishing to check in", "Any
500 stations...", etc. All seemed to be native English
speakers.
-
This is Canadian Forces Affiliate Radio System (CFARS), the Canadian equivalent of the US Military Affiliate Radio System (MARS). Sometimes you can hear both CFARS and MARS stations in the net.
